On Mon, Nov 8, 2021 at 3:01 PM Jonathan Tan <jonathantanmy@google.com> wrote:
>
> > + reader.options &= ~PACKET_READ_REDACT_URI_PATH;
>
> Probably worth commenting why you're resetting the flag (avoid the
> relatively expensive URI check when we don't need it).
Done
>
> > diff --git a/pkt-line.c b/pkt-line.c
...
> > + len = strspn(buffer, "0123456789abcdefABCDEF");
> > + if (len != (int)the_hash_algo->hexsz || buffer[len] != ' ')
> > + return NULL; /* required "<hash>SP" not seen */
>
> Optional: As I said in my reply (just sent out), checking for both SHA-1
> and SHA-256 lengths is reasonable too.
Done (with a comment indicating they are the hash sizes of SHA1 and SHA256)
> > + GIT_TRACE=1 GIT_TRACE_PACKET="$(pwd)/log" GIT_TEST_SIDEBAND_ALL=1 \
>
> No need for GIT_TRACE=1 since you're not checking stdout. Also I don't
> think GIT_TEST_SIDEBAND_ALL=1 is needed - we should check that it works
> even without a test variable (and I've checked and it seems to work).
Done in both tests.
